SpaceX’s June 2026 Nasdaq debut at a roughly $1.9 trillion valuation capped the exchange’s strongest recent quarter of coverage, centered on landmark listings and new-market expansion.

Who they are

Nasdaq appears in this coverage primarily as a U.S. exchange and listing venue for IPOs, direct listings and other public-market debuts. It also features as a market operator pursuing adjacent financial infrastructure, including an investment in Kraken parent Payward after Kraken’s plan to distribute Nasdaq tokenized stocks.

The recent arc

Coverage reached its all-time quarterly high in 2026Q2, driven overwhelmingly by SpaceX’s choice of Nasdaq, its public IPO filing and its June debut. CNBC reported that SpaceX opened at $150 after pricing at $135, then closed its first session up 19% at $160.95; the stories tied the listing to a roughly $1.9 trillion to $2.1 trillion market value and Elon Musk becoming the first trillionaire. The same period also included the SEC’s earlier approval of exchange applications, including Nasdaq’s, to list spot ether ETFs, underscoring Nasdaq’s role beyond conventional equity listings.

The post-SpaceX coverage has broadened into a run of technology-, crypto- and international-market entries: SK Hynix raised $26.5 billion in a Nasdaq debut described as the largest U.S. market debut by a foreign company; French quantum company Pasqal surged after a SPAC merger; and Ionic Digital rose more than 25% after a direct listing. In September, Bloomberg reported Nasdaq’s $100 million investment in Payward, while Business Insider reported that Anthropic had selected Nasdaq for a potential IPO.

The tension

The persistent competitive tension is the contest for consequential listings against the NYSE, visible in coverage of Twitter’s decision to list in New York and in both exchanges’ participation in the SEC-approved spot ether ETF applications. Nasdaq’s recent edge in the corpus comes from attracting marquee and technology-linked issuers such as SpaceX, SK Hynix, Pasqal and Ionic, while its Payward investment connects the exchange to crypto market infrastructure rather than merely serving as a venue for listed securities.

Why it matters

If the current pattern continues, Nasdaq could strengthen its position as the preferred public-market gateway for large technology, AI-adjacent, semiconductor, quantum and crypto-connected companies, with headline listings reinforcing that positioning. That outcome is not assured: post-debut volatility, illustrated by SK Hynix’s subsequent decline in Seoul, and regulatory decisions around products such as crypto ETFs can shape whether attention converts into sustained trading and listing momentum.
